Sorting different strings of text
 
I'm trying to sort a column of text separtated by commas, where the same
strings may not always be in the same order within the cells. I'm trying to
run a pivot off these codes, but I'll probably double the size of the chart
if I can't sort.

Sorting different strings of text
 
You could use TEXT TO COLUMNS to split out the strings
You may have to do a global search and replace for spaces
Sort the results (from left to right)
Concatenate them back together with =A1 & ", " & B1 ... etc
